Author's Notes

MAKE AHEAD: Prepare this dish ahead of time, cover it, and place it in the fridge. When ready to enjoy, bake as directed.
FOR VEGAN: Use coconut oil or vegan butter in the topping. Leave the egg out of the potatoes.
FOR GLUTEN-FREE: This recipe is naturally gluten-free, just ensure your oats are certified gluten-free.
Cooking InstructionsHide images
step 1
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Spray an 8x8-inch (or 2 quarts) baking dish with nonstick cooking spray and set aside.
step 2
Scrub Sweet Potatoes (3.5 lb) clean and prick them about 5 times each with a fork. Place them on a baking sheet lined with foil and roast until tender, about 1 hour depending on the size of the potatoes.
step 3
Remove potatoes from the oven and let them cool for about 5 minutes.
step 4
Lower oven heat to 350 degrees F (180 degrees C).
step 5
Peel and discard the skins. Place the chunks of the potatoes into a large mixing bowl. Add Maple Syrup (1/3 cup), Vanilla Extract (1 tsp), Egg (1), Ground Cinnamon (1 tsp), Ground Nutmeg (as needed), Ground Ginger (as needed), and Salt (as needed). You can mash the potatoes and stir everything together with a fork or use an electric mixer to mix until everything is combined.

step 6
Transfer potato mixture into a prepared baking dish and spread out evenly.
step 7
Make the topping by mixing together the Old Fashioned Rolled Oats (1 cup), Almond Meal (1/2 cup), Dark Brown Sugar (1 Tbsp), Ground Cinnamon (as needed), and Chopped Pecans (1/3 cup). Stir in the Butter (4 Tbsp) until everything is evenly mixed. Sprinkle topping over the top of the sweet potato mixture.

step 8
Bake uncovered. The Casserole is done when the edges and top start to slightly brown, about 30 minutes.
step 9
Remove from oven and let cool for 5-10 minutes. Enjoy warm!
